About: I have worked as a Cat Groomer and Pet Care Specialist at The Whole Cat and Kaboodle for 2 years and I currently work as a Kennel Technician at Purrfect Cat Boarding and Cat Groomer at Alex the Cat Groomer. At the Whole Cat and Kaboodle I provide therapeutic grooming for severely matted and pelted cats. I can perform the 3 main hair cuts for cats, Classic Lion, Velvet Lion and Teddy Bear. I am also very apt at handling more fractious cats. In addition I also handle the day to day care of our cats. I am able to provide simple medical assistance such as, giving fluids through an IV, treating diabetic cats with insulin, and administering medication as needed. I upgraded our boarding system to better organize our where are cats stay, what foods they are eating and to better track any behavioral or medical issues We also provide high end, limited ingredient Dog and Cat food, which I am a consultant on. Limited ingredient food provides the best nutrition available and can help alleviate symptoms such as, UTI, Hairballs, Behavioral issues, etc. without costly vet bills or medication. At Purrfect Cat Boarding, I take care of over 50+ cats a day. I am responsible for food distribution, kennel cleaning and disinfecting to King County’s health standards as well as handling medication distribution such as giving insulin shots, IV Fluids and pills I have do experience volunteering at shelters and I work with a non-profit group called FCAT that traps feral cats and strays and provides them with spay/neuter services and vaccines. A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your dog,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.

Sitters on Rover set their own cancellation policy, which you can find on their profile under their calendar availability.

Cancelling before a booking begins and before the sitter's cutoff time qualifies you for a full refund. Same-day cancellations for walks, day care, and drop-ins follow the full refund policy. Otherwise, for dog boarding and house sitting, you will receive a 50% refund for the first seven days of the booking and a 100% refund for the remaining days when you cancel the same day a booking should begin.

If your sitter needs to cancel within seven days of the booking's start date, then our reservation protection will kick in. This means our support team works with you to find a replacement sitter.
